Visiting potential communities is the single most important step. Schedule tours and go more than once, if possible. Try to visit during an activity or mealtime to see the community in motion. Pay close attention to the interactions between staff and residents—are they warm, respectful, and patient? Observe the cleanliness, the safety features, and the overall ambiance. Does it feel bright and inviting? For a loved one accustomed to South Dakota’s wide-open spaces, ask about secured outdoor areas or garden spaces where they can enjoy fresh air. Inquire about how the community handles our distinct seasons, ensuring comfortable indoor activities during the long winter months and safe enjoyment of the summer.
When evaluating care, move beyond the basic services. Ask detailed questions about medication management, assistance with bathing and dressing, and how care plans are created and updated. It’s also crucial to understand the social and emotional support offered. Look for a calendar of activities that encourages engagement and new friendships. For many seniors from agricultural communities, activities that feel purposeful, like gardening clubs or baking groups, can be particularly meaningful. Don’t forget to have a frank conversation about costs, what is included in the base fee, and what incurs additional charges. Transparency here prevents difficult surprises later.
